Road I/44 Bludov — bypass

The subject of the project is the transfer of road I/44, which includes the bypass of the municipality of Bludov and the feeder to the town of Šumperk. The length of the main route is 5 635 m, the feeder has a length of 1 278 m. The municipality of Bludov is the last building in the direction from Mohelnice to Šumperk dealing with the transfer of road I/44 in a four-strip arrangement so that the town of Šumperk and its related catchment area are connected to the motorway network of the Czech Republic.
